20 to 21 July, Friday and Saturday
Money or socialism? panel with Frans Timmerman and Anitra Nelson at the two-day Australasian Historical Materialism conference. This session will focus on leftist controversies surrounding key points in the first four chapters of Life Without Money: i.e. the revolutionary significance of consciously thinking and acting on the basis of use values rather than exchange values; problems caused by retaining money in a transition to socialism; the revolutionary potential of an autonomist Marxist position of refusing to work; and, acknowledging money as a tool of power (rather than efficiency) and organising principle of capitalism.

15 May 2012, Tuesday, 4 pm to 5.30 pm (Parrallel session 5 on Relating)
'Degrowth equals regrowth: A discussion of Eduardo Galeano's work' paper by Anitra Nelson at the International Degrowth in the Americas Conference in Monteal, Quebec, Canada (HEC Montréal, L’Oréal Canada — see paper, R043). This paper discusses the nature of degrowth in the context of the missing chapter in Life Without Money — a chapter based on numerous extracts from Eduardo Galeano's voluminous work was to be included but withdrawn from proposed publication due to copyright issues.
